CASLAD was established in 2009 as a buyer and seller of castors, ladders, trolleys, scaffolding, and a wide range of other industrial products. Over time, our industry experience, product knowledge, and strong customer relationships have allowed CASLAD to evolve. We have expanded into a direct importer of castors and materials handling equipment, and have become a leading manufacturer of steel trolleys, fibreglass ladders, and aluminium ladders. In 2024, we launched our on-site plating plant as part of our manufacturing expansion. CASLAD operates from a 5,500m² manufacturing and distribution centre in Jet Park, Boksburg, supported by regional branches and distribution warehouses in Cape Town, KZN, and Bloemfontein.
